My friends dad just bought a 01 Buick Regal and it has the 3.8 Supercharged motor so we took it for a drive. He was driving it hard for a while and then we whent back to his house. When we got out we noticed smoke coming from under the car and a yellow glow. So I open the hood and the front of the motor is on fire a round the manifold. I had a bottle of chocolate milk so I dump it on the fire as my friend got a bucket of water. We got the fire out be for anything got hurt. The front manifold was glowing red hot so I think it caught oil on fire that was on the block. The valve cover gaskets are bad so there was a lot of oil on the block. My friend and I never looked under the hood be for we drove it.We think the catalytic converter is plugged.
